There are two primary kinds of veggies: cool-season and warm-season. Cool-season vegetables can tolerate frost and can be grown in very early spring or fall. Warm-season vegetables can not tolerate frost and also has to be grown after the last frost date.

The best time to plant veggies relies on the sort of vegetable as well as the climate. As a whole, cool-season vegetables must be grown in very early springtime or autumn, as well as warm-season vegetables need to be planted after the last frost date.

When it involves veggie horticulture, timing is whatever. Understanding when to plant your vegetables is necessary for effective harvests throughout the season. Early spring is the perfect time to get your veggie yard began.

The very best veggies to plant in early spring include:

  • Lettuce— Lettuce is a cool-season plant that can be planted in early spring. Plant lettuce completely sunlight or partial shade as well as keep the soil moist. Harvest lettuce when the fallen leaves are still young as well as tender.
  • Radishes— Radishes are one more cool-season crop that can be planted in early spring. Plant radishes in complete sunlight and keep the soil moist. Harvest radishes when they are still small as well as company.
  • Spinach— Spinach is a cool-season crop that can be planted in very early spring. Plant spinach completely sun or partial shade and keep the soil moist. Harvest spinach when the leaves are still young and tender.
  • Carrots— Carrots are a cool-season crop that can be planted in early springtime. Plant carrots in full sun and keep the dirt moist. Harvest carrots when they are still small as well as company.
  • Peas— Peas are a cool-season crop that can be grown in early springtime. Plant peas in full sun and keep the soil moist. Harvest peas when the cases are still young and tender.
  • Beetroots— Beets are a cool-season crop that can be grown in very early spring. Plant beets in complete sun and maintain the soil moist. Harvest beetroots when they are still tiny and firm.
  • Cabbage— Cabbage is a cool-season crop that can be grown in very early spring. Plant cabbage completely sun or partial color and also maintain the soil moist. Harvest cabbage when the heads are still young and also tender.
  • Broccoli— Broccoli is a cool-season crop that can be grown in early springtime. Plant broccoli in full sun or partial color and maintain the dirt moist. Harvest broccoli when the heads are still young and tender.
  • Kale— Kale is a cool-season plant that can be planted in very early spring. Plant kale in full sunlight or partial color and maintain the dirt moist. Harvest kale when the fallen leaves are still young and tender.
  • Onions— Onions are a cool-season crop that can be planted in very early springtime. Plant onions in full sun as well as maintain the soil moist. Harvest onions when they are still tiny as well as firm.
  • Garlic— Garlic is a cool-season plant that can be planted in very early springtime. Plant garlic in complete sun and keep the soil moist. Harvest garlic when the bulbs are still little and also firm.
